Hash key
Hashing your data can be useful if you need to validate the authenticity and integrity of your data. The Hash Key action hashes the value of a key in every record. When applied to your pipeline, the Hash Key action hashes the value of every occurrence of a specific key and return the hashed algorithm value and a new key name. The Hash Key action provides the MD5 and SHA256 functions for hashing your keys.

To hash the value of every occurrence of user_id
:
- In the processing rules tab, in the Actions dropdown, select Allow keys.
- In the Source key field, enter
user_id
. - In the Destination key field, enter
customer_id
. - Use the dropdowns to select the hashing algorithm to use and the scheme of your output.
- Click Apply.
Your processing rule will now hash the value of every occurrence of the user_id
key
and return it as customer_id
and the hashed value.
